What Is a Vegan Keratin Treatment?
A vegan keratin treatment is a hair-smoothing process that uses plant-based or synthetic alternatives instead of animal-derived keratin. Traditional keratin treatments often use keratin extracted from animal sources such as feathers, horns, or wool. In contrast, vegan versions rely on amino acids, proteins from plants, and other natural compounds to mimic the strengthening effects of keratin.
The main goal of a vegan keratin treatment is to repair damaged hair, reduce frizz, and create a smoother appearance while maintaining a cruelty-free formulation. It works by coating the hair shaft and helping to seal the cuticle, which results in shinier and more manageable hair.

How Vegan Keratin Treatment Works
The process of vegan keratin treatment is similar to traditional keratin smoothing treatments but uses different ingredients. It typically involves applying a protein-rich formula to the hair, which is then sealed using heat from a flat iron or styling tool.
The treatment works by filling in gaps in the hair cuticle, which are often caused by damage, heat styling, or environmental stress. Once the hair is sealed, it becomes smoother, shinier, and easier to manage.
Step 1 Hair Preparation
The hair is washed with a clarifying shampoo to remove buildup, oils, and impurities. This allows the treatment to penetrate more effectively.
Step 2 Application of Treatment
The vegan keratin formula is applied evenly throughout the hair, ensuring that each strand is coated with the protein-rich solution.
Step 3 Heat Sealing
A flat iron is used to seal the treatment into the hair. The heat helps lock in the ingredients and create a smooth, frizz-free finish.
Main Ingredients in Vegan Keratin Treatments
Vegan keratin treatments rely on plant-based proteins and natural compounds that mimic the structure and function of keratin. These ingredients help strengthen and repair hair without using animal-derived materials.
- Hydrolyzed wheat protein for strengthening hair strands
- Rice protein to improve elasticity and smoothness
- Soy protein for moisture and repair
- Amino acids to support hair structure
- Natural oils like argan or coconut oil for hydration
These ingredients work together to improve hair texture while maintaining a vegan-friendly formulation.

Differences Between Vegan and Traditional Keratin Treatments
While both vegan and traditional keratin treatments aim to smooth and strengthen hair, they differ significantly in ingredients and formulation. Traditional keratin treatments often use animal-derived keratin and may contain strong chemical agents to achieve long-lasting results.
Vegan keratin treatments, on the other hand, rely on plant-based proteins and tend to avoid harsh chemicals. This makes them a gentler option for people who are concerned about scalp sensitivity or chemical exposure.
- Vegan keratin plant-based and cruelty-free
- Traditional keratin may include animal-derived ingredients
- Vegan options are generally gentler on the scalp
- Results may vary in duration and intensity

Aftercare for Vegan Keratin Treatment
Proper aftercare is essential to maintain the results of a vegan keratin treatment. Following specific hair care routines can help extend the smooth and shiny effect of the treatment.
It is usually recommended to use sulfate-free shampoos and conditioners to avoid stripping the treatment from the hair. Limiting heat styling can also help preserve the results for a longer period.
- Use sulfate-free hair products
- Avoid washing hair too frequently
- Reduce excessive heat styling
- Apply nourishing hair oils if needed
Possible Limitations
Although vegan keratin treatments offer many benefits, they also have some limitations. The results may not last as long as some traditional chemical-based treatments.
Additionally, extremely coarse or highly damaged hair may require multiple sessions to achieve desired results. It is important to have realistic expectations based on hair type and condition.
- Shorter-lasting results compared to chemical treatments
- May require repeated applications for best effect
- Results vary depending on hair texture
